Wheat flour conveying is a critical process in the flour milling industry, ensuring efficient movement of flour from storage to processing or packaging areas. The choice of conveying method depends on factors such as flour characteristics, production scale, and operational requirements. Below are some common methods used for wheat flour conveying, highlighting their applications and advantages.

1. Screw Conveyors for Wheat Flour
Screw conveyors, also known as auger conveyors, are widely used for wheat flour conveying due to their ability to handle dry, free-flowing materials like flour. These systems consist of a rotating screw (auger) inside a cylindrical tube, which moves the flour forward through the conveyor. Screw conveyors are particularly suitable for vertical or inclined transport, allowing for efficient elevation changes while maintaining a controlled flow rate. They are often used in small to medium-scale flour mills, where space constraints and the need for gentle material handling are important considerations. The smooth interior of the screw prevents flour from sticking, reducing blockages and ensuring consistent performance. This method is cost-effective and easy to install, making it a popular choice for many flour processing facilities.
2. Pneumatic Conveying Systems

Pneumatic conveying, or air-based transport, is another common method for wheat flour handling. This system uses air pressure to move flour through a pipeline network. There are two main types: pressure and vacuum systems. Pressure systems push flour using compressed air, while vacuum systems draw flour using a vacuum pump. Pneumatic conveying offers advantages such as the ability to transport flour over long distances and through multiple points of discharge. It is also suitable for handling fine powders and can be integrated with other processing equipment, such as mixers or packaging machines. However, pneumatic systems require proper air filtration to prevent dust accumulation and may need higher energy consumption compared to mechanical conveyors. They are commonly used in large-scale flour mills where high throughput and flexibility are required.
3. Belt Conveyors for Bulk Flour Transport
Belt conveyors are widely used in the agricultural and food processing industries for transporting bulk materials, including wheat flour. These systems consist of a continuous belt that moves over rollers or pulleys, carrying the flour from one location to another. Belt conveyors are suitable for horizontal or slightly inclined transport and can handle large volumes of flour efficiently. They are often used in combination with other equipment, such as hoppers and elevators, to form a complete flour handling system. The design of the belt conveyor can be customized to accommodate different flour types and moisture levels, ensuring optimal performance. Belt conveyors are known for their durability and low maintenance requirements, making them a reliable choice for long-term operation. They are particularly effective in environments where continuous and uninterrupted transport is essential.

4. Bucket Elevators for Vertical Flour Conveying
Bucket elevators are specialized conveyors designed for vertical transport of wheat flour. These systems use a series of buckets attached to a chain or belt, which move vertically to lift flour from lower to upper levels. Bucket elevators are highly efficient for vertical conveying, with the ability to handle large quantities of flour at high speeds. They are commonly used in flour mills where vertical space is limited, and the need to elevate flour to higher processing levels is required. The design of the bucket elevator ensures minimal material spillage and efficient use of space, making it a preferred choice for vertical flour transport. However, bucket elevators may require more maintenance than other types of conveyors due to the moving parts and the need to handle abrasive flour particles. Proper lubrication and regular inspection are essential to maintain their performance and longevity.
